Q » What is Needle loom in the textile industry?

A » A needle loom is a specialized machine in the textile industry used for producing non-woven fabrics. It operates by entangling fibers through a series of barbed needles that repeatedly penetrate the fiber web. This mechanical bonding process creates sturdy materials like felt without the need for weaving or knitting, making needle looms essential for applications requiring durable fabric structures, such as automotive interiors and geotextiles.

A »In the textile industry, a needle loom is a specialized machine used for weaving narrow fabrics such as ribbons, belts, and tapes. It operates by interlacing warp and weft threads with the help of needles, offering precision and efficiency. Ideal for producing strong, durable materials, needle looms are essential for applications requiring high-quality woven products.
